Veterans, including Jack Fessler of the Alton VFW Post 1308, shake the hands of North Elementary students. Photo by Jan Dona, L&C Media Services

Lewis and Clark Veterans Services, along with North Elementary School students and the Alton High School ROTC, gathered with a group of area veterans Nov. 8 in recognition of Veterans Day. The ROTC presented the colors, while students recited the pledge and members of the fifth-grade choir sang the national anthem. Each student was given a flag provided by L&C Veterans Services. Following the ceremony, students were able to meet the veterans and thank them for their service.
